Grading Policy:
Grades are based on the accumulation of points.
Classwork
20%
Participation, Notebook
5%
Homework
10%
Assessments (tests and quizzes)
40%
Projects
25%

IF YOU ARE ABSENT: Be proactive, feel free to ask for missed work from the
teacher. You will have two days to make up missed work and notes for each day
you have been absent. Students will choose two note buddies to get notes from if
they are absent.
Science Notebook Grades:
Students will record their essential question responses, objectives, notes, and
various classroom assignments/labs in their science notebooks. These notebooks
will be collected and assigned a grade based on the quality and completion of notes
and assignments which is outlined in the rubric glued in the front of each notebook.
Notebooks MUST be brought back from home after studying for a test.
